Frost covers what the stegosaurus looked like, what it did and the demise of the dinosaur. Readers can relate easily to its dimensions--about the length of a school bus--with measurements presented in both feet and meters. Clear photographs of dioramas illustrate the text most effectively such as in the scene in which the stegosaurus uses its spiked tail, one of its unique characteristics, to defend itself. The glossary and index are well organized, and subject-specific terms are clearly defined. The vocabulary and content should be of interest to older readers, and the more curious students will find links to additional online resources. The translation flows smoothly and is void of regional expressions.
